双主塔同日封顶!北沿江高铁崇启公铁长江大桥建设迎来重大进展
Yang Zi Wan Bao Wang· 2025-09-29 06:26
Core Points - The construction of the Chongqi Railway and Highway Yangtze River Bridge, the world's largest span railway and highway cable-stayed bridge, is currently underway, marking a significant milestone in infrastructure development [1][3] - The bridge will allow for a high-speed crossing of the Yangtze River at a speed of 350 km/h without reduction, enhancing transportation efficiency [1][5] Group 1: Bridge Specifications - The Chongqi Bridge spans 4.09 kilometers and features a dual-layer design, with the upper layer accommodating a six-lane highway and the lower layer designed for high-speed and intercity railways [3][4] - The main navigation span of the bridge reaches 400 meters, making it the largest span railway and highway cable-stayed bridge under construction globally [3][4] Group 2: Construction Challenges and Innovations - The construction faced challenges due to complex geological conditions, including soft sandy soil, and tidal influences affecting the construction process [4] - The project has achieved several records, including the longest steel beam push length of 1205.4 meters for a railway and highway bridge, and the implementation of a new structural design combining concrete slabs and steel trusses [4] Group 3: Economic and Regional Impact - The completion of the bridge is expected to optimize the railway network layout along the Yangtze River, contributing to the integrated development of the Yangtze River Delta and promoting high-quality growth in the region [5]
长江“在此”
Chang Jiang Ri Bao· 2025-05-06 00:29
Core Insights - Wuhan has emerged as one of the top ten popular tourist cities in China during the "May Day" holiday, with hotel bookings increasing by 8%, ticket orders rising by nearly 35%, and inbound travel orders growing by 66% [1][2][6] Group 1: Tourism Growth - The "May Day" holiday saw a significant increase in tourism activities in Wuhan, with a total of 90,000 visitors at the riverside areas [3] - The "Long River Deck Sound Party" was a major highlight, attracting over 6,000 visitors on the Guqin ship alone during the holiday [2] - The total number of visitors for the two rivers cruise reached 36,000 over five days, marking a 33.3% year-on-year increase, with revenue up by 16.5% [2] Group 2: Cultural and Recreational Developments - Wuhan's riverside areas have been transformed into vibrant cultural and recreational spaces, featuring night tours and various themed activities that appeal to younger audiences [3][4] - The "Two Mountains and One Bridge" tourism route gained popularity, showcasing the integration of ecological restoration and cultural tourism [4][5] - The city is actively promoting its cultural heritage through events like the "Long River Tourism Season," which will run until the end of August, aiming to enhance regional tourism collaboration [6] Group 3: Future Prospects - Wuhan plans to leverage the Yangtze River as a cultural tourism brand, collaborating with nearby cities to create a "Poetic Corridor" along the river [6] - Upcoming events, such as the "Ten Thousand Gardenias" theme activity, aim to foster tourism exchanges among cities in the Yangtze River region [6] - The city is positioned to continue its growth in the cultural tourism sector, with the Yangtze River serving as a vital resource for future developments [6]
